Juoksa Open 2023

27.3.2023

Opening shots of the summer in Orimattila

Juoksa Bowhunting Association is organising a competition on its 31-target 3D course in Orimattila: Juoksa Open 2023 competition Sunday, 4 June 2023. Registration opens at 10:00 and the competition starts promptly at 11:00. Welcome to experience our course, which has already received excellent reviews. Bring blunt points and broadheads, of course.

The competition follows the SJML Cup competition ruleswhich can be found on the association’s www.jousimetsastys.fi website. The most important point is that competitors must have either a valid hunting card or another personal accident insurance policy. At registration, competitors must be able to demonstrate that they meet this participation requirement.

The competition entry fee is EUR 20 and juniors and young people under 15 may participate free of charge. Payment can be made in cash or by MobilePay at registration. Advance registrations can be sent by email to jousimetsastysjuoksa@gmail.comor by text message to +358 44 3777101 or through the form on these pages viestilomakkeella. When registering in advance, please state your name and the class in which you intend to compete. Advance registration is not mandatory, but it significantly helps event organisation.

Iron Deer (Odocoileus Ferromineus); a challenge competition in which the gong does not ring for the winner.

After the main Cup competition, if there is sufficient interest, a challenge competition will be held: “Call of the Iron Deer” The target is our course’s newest attraction, which announces a poorly placed shot very loudly and with final consequences for the arrow. Anyone familiar with Lancaster Archery’s Steel Elk Challenge will recognise the format: a miss eliminates the archer.

In the Call of the Iron Deer, archers shoot from progressively longer distances, up to 100 metres if necessary, until a winner is determined. Juniors and the traditional class begin at 10 metres, while compound archers begin at 40 metres. Following the principle familiar from EPJM’s Snowman competition, an archer may purchase one additional make-up shot for a nominal fee of €10. The winner receives fame, glory and a prize; the losers get their own arrows back in an entirely new form.

The competition venue address is Ollostentie 115, Orimattila. Traffic control is provided for parking at the competition venue.
